Модули ядра: как оверрайдить автоопределение при загрузке...

Jun 14, 2009 12:01

Есть модуль zr36067. Он все от той же tv-карты которую я мучаю.

По нынешнему состоянию дел этот модуль не умеет корректно автодетектить карточки, а вместо этого просто загружает модуль в состоянии черти-как. Потому для того чтобы оно работало надо сказать:

$ sudo rmmod zr36067
$ sudo modprobe zr36067 card=1

И все взлетает.

Однако добавление zr36067 card=1 в /etc/modules не помогает, ибо модуль уже загружен при загрузке ядра, только криво...

Внимание вопрос, как штатно (без правки инит скриптов и прочей х--ни) обучить систему либо не загружать этот модуль при автодетекте, либо после автодетекта перзагружать этот модуль с правильными параметрами.

Система Debian.
Update:
# echo blacklist zr36067 >> /etc/modprobe.d/blacklist
# echo zr36067 card=1 >> /etc/modules

linux

Previous post Next post
Up